Northbound Gladstone Street between Sutherland Avenue and Disraeli Freeway will be closed to traffic from October 3 to 10

Released: October 2, 2019 at 1:30 p.m.
Motorists should use alternate routes and allow additional travel time

Winnipeg, MB – Northbound Gladstone Street between Sutherland Avenue and Disraeli Freeway will be completely closed to traffic starting Thursday, October 3 at 9 a.m. until 6 p.m. on Thursday, October 10 for water services repairs. As part of this closure, the ramp to Gladstone Street from northbound Disraeli will also be completely closed due to the work on Gladstone; however, access to northbound Disraeli, from Gladstone Street, will remain open.

Pedestrian access will be maintained. Motorists are encouraged to use alternative routes during this time.
